Basic principles and applications of probability theory
This introductory chapter discusses such notions as determinism, chaos and randomness, p- dictibility and unpredictibility, some initial approaches to formalizing r- domness and it surveys certain problems that can be solved by probability theory. This will perhaps give one an idea to what extent the theory can - swer questions arising in speci?c random occurrences and the character of the answers provided by the theory. 1. 1 The Nature of Randomness The phrase “by chance” has no single meaning in ordinary language. For instance, it may mean unpremeditated, nonobligatory, unexpected, and so on. Its opposite sense is simpler: “not by chance” signi?es obliged to or bound to (happen). In philosophy, necessity counteracts randomness. Necessity signi?es conforming to law – it can be expressed by an exact law. The basic laws of mechanics, physics and astronomy can be formulated in terms of precise quantitativerelationswhichmustholdwithironcladnecessity.

Banking Sector Liberalization in India : Evaluation of Reforms and Comparative Perspectives on China
Banking Sector Liberalization in India explores in detail the changes in the Indian banking sector over the last 20 years, and puts them into a comparative perspective with the Chinese banking sector. For this purpose, the author develops a detailed indicator-based framework for assessing the liberalization of a banking sector along various process steps based on financial liberalization and transformation studies. This framework, along with the indicators for the process and the results of liberalization, is applied to the banking sectors in India and China to test for the effects of liberalization on the sector and the macro level. The key finding is that while liberalization has improved the sectoral performance, it has so far had no effect on the macro level. The book features a detailed description of recent reforms in the Indian banking sector, a set of indicators for evaluating banking sector reforms, and a large number of graphs with key figures for the banking sectors in India and China.

Bacteriocins : Ecology and Evolution
Microbes produce an extraordinary array of defense systems. These include bacteriocins, a class of antimicrobial molecules with narrow killing spectra, produced by bacteria. The book describes the diversity and ecological role of bacteriocins of Gram-positive and Gram-negative bacteria, presenting a new classification scheme for the former and a state-of-the-art look at the role of bacteriocins in bacterial communication. It discusses the molecular evolution of colicins and colicin-like bacteriocins, and provides a contemporary overview of archaeocins, bacteriocin-like antimicrobials produced by archaebacteria. Furthermore, various modeling (in silico) studies elucidate the role of bacteriocins in microbial community dynamics and fitness, delving into rock-paper-scissors competition and the counter-intuitive survival of the weakest. The book makes compelling reading for a multi-faceted scientific audience, including those working in the fields of biodiversity and biotechnology, notably in the human and animal health domain.
